⭐️Royal Albert Hall⭐️ Royal Albert hall of Arts and Sciences is a concert hall on the northen edge of South Kensigton, London. It is constructed during the reign of Queen Victoria in 1871 in tribute to queen victoria’s deceased consort, prince Albert. Now it is the center of different cultures of world music and arts and since its opening the world’s leading artists from different countries have performed their versatile talents here. This hall is best known for holding ‘The proms’ concerts annually each summer since 1941. It is a magnificent building built in Italianate style and its capacity is 5,272 seats. Each year it hosts more than 350 events, which means sometimes more than one program in a single day. The programs including classical concerts, rock and pop, ballet and opera, sports, award ceremonies are some of them. School and community events, charity performances and even banquets are hosted in the hall. The BBC Promenade concerts, known as :The Proms” is a popular annual eight-week summer season of classical music concerts and other events at the hall, so the hall is affectionately titled as “the nation’s Village hall”. Classic Brit awards, Graduation ceremonies of some universities or colleges, festival of rememberence are some of the functions held here each year.
